hello guys. After a hard night, i managed to find a solution for our problem.

in order to fix the "no service" issue, not able to reciece/send calls or sms, please follow these steps.

but before telling you how to fix it, you must know that this problem is caused by firmware and hardware issue. the main hardware issue is the sim card reader hardware in the 4s. it somehow freez and stop working whenever a 64 K micro sim card is placed. and as my research showed that 40 % of micro sim cards all over the world are 64 K while the others are 128 K. switching your sim card to a 128 K sim will fix it for sure ( if you follow my instructions ). and for some people in India, Brazil, Lebanon and such coutries where complaints are high, i advice you to buy a regular 128 sim card ( not micro sim ) and cut it by yourself and i promise you that it will work. But if your phone allready frezzed before and showed the errors, the possibilty that it will work by just switching the sim card is low.


SO AFTER PLACING THE NEW SIM CARD

1- download latest itunes 10.5.1

2- downloas ios 5.0.1 ( from itunes not from iphone device )

3- restore as new iphone (to avoid any remaining traces of previous corruption caused by hardware error)

4- Go to Settings --> Phone --> Sim Pin and turn it OFF

5- Turn On airplane mode and wait 15 seconds

6- Turn OFF airplane mode

7- Go to Settings --> Carrier --> Automatic ( turn it off and select your network manually )


AND THE PROBLEM IS FIXED
